Microsoft Discovers E-Commerce
With only 12 day left to go before the Great Vista Rollout to consumers on January 30 and missing no trick, Microsoft said late Wednesday that it would break with its tradition of boxed or pre-loaded software and supply the thing online. It's come up with three ways for customers to buy, upgrade or license multiple copies of Vista over the net: Windows Anytime Upgrade, Windows Marketplace and Windows Vista Family Discount. The Windows Anytime Upgrade will let people upgrade their existing edition of Vista to a fancier one by clicking the Windows Anytime Upgrade option in the Start menu, selecting what they want, buying it online and getting a new digital key that unlocks the code, which is already on their machine, and then following the on-screen instructions to boot the upgrade.
